Across Italy there are many half-empty towns,nearly abandoned by those who migrate to the coast or to cities. The beautifulcrumbling hilltop town of Becchina is among thembut its mayor has taken drastic measures to rebuildΓÇöselling abandoned homes to anyone in the world for a single Euroas long as the buyer promises to live there for at least five years. ItΓÇÖs a no-brainer for American couple Tommy and Kate Puglisi. Both work remotelyand Becchina is the home of TommyΓÇÖs grandparentshis closest living relatives. It feels like a romantic adventurean opportunity the young couple would be crazy not to seize. But from the moment they move inthey both feel a shadow has fallen on them. TommyΓÇÖs grandmother is furiouseven a little frightenedwhen she realizes which house theyΓÇÖve bought. There are rooms in an annex at the back of the house that they didnΓÇÖt know were there. The place makes strange noises at nightlocked doors are suddenly openand when they go to a family gatheringtheyΓÇÖre certain people are whispering about themand about their housewhich one neighbor refers to as The House of Last Resort. Soonthey learn that the home was owned for generations by the Churchbut the real secretand the true dreadis unlocked when they finally learn what the priests were doing in this house for all those long years…and how many people died in the strange chapel inside. While down in the catacombs beneath Becchina…something stirs.
